  • My '63 Chevy II has a Heidts front clip replacement & rear 4 link suspension w/ sub frame connectors The car was set up on a set of scales, adjusting the coil (#400lb) heights . With that rough set up I competed in an autocross & I killed a lot of newer cars with fancier set ups (can't compete with an Elise though). I added progressive springs and the street ride is comfortable and controlled. The car weighs 2,860 lbs with a 450hp injected 383 SB, T56 W/3.73's. Runs great
